Given inequalities below and we are looking for a pair with no solution.
Let's verify:
A) x > 3 and x < 2,
- It has no solutions since the two inequalities have no common interval.
B) x > - 3 and x < - 2,
- Its solution is -3 < x < - 2, the interval between two given endpoints.
C) x > - 3 and x < 2,
- Similar to option B, the interval is between two endpoints:
D) x > - 3 and x > - 2,
- Its solution is x > - 2, the two inequalities cover almost same interval.
